Description

The J.P. Morgan Wealth Management (USWM) business is focused on helping investors achieve their long-term financial goals and is comprised of the Chase wealth management business, J.P. Morgan Advisors, Personal Advisors and Self-Directed - our digital investing platform. The combined business has ~$600 billion in Assets Under Management and ~5,000 advisors located across 3,500 branches and 20 offices.
